An Indian bride sits during a mass marriage ceremony for some 187 low-income couples from the India-Pakistan border area at Gurdwara Baba Jallan Dass in the village of Naushehra Dhala, some 50kms from Amritsar on April 15, 2011. Marriage is a costly affair in India prompting some parents to have their children married at mass marriages, allowing them to save money on organisational costs. This mass marriage function was organized by Pehalwan Kanwarjeet Singh Sandhu. AFP PHOTO/NARINDER NANU (Photo credit should read NARINDER NANU/AFP/Getty Images)
